Is CLAYTON COUNTY WATER AUTHORITY Water Safe to Drink?
CLAYTON COUNTY WATER AUTHORITY has reported 9 contaminants above EPA health-based guidelines (MCLGs) in at least one city served. We recommend reviewing individual city reports below for specific water quality details.
This utility serves 298,374 people across 7 cities in GA. Water quality can vary by location within the service area. Check individual city pages below for detailed contaminant data specific to your area.
